Key Points
Calcium-iron modified biochar significantly improves soil properties and nutrient availability in saline-alkali conditions.
The study indicates an increase in organic matter content and nutrient retention by over 30% with the use of biochar.
Assessment using soil chemistry analysis demonstrates the biochemical mechanisms behind the amelioration effect.
Findings highlight the potential for using biochar to mitigate salinity issues, emphasizing the need for broader application in coastal regions.
